Conk/Robillard Family Tree » Barbe Lechevalier (1618-1663)

Personal data Barbe Lechevalier 

Source 1
  • She was born in the year 1618 in St Martin, Rouen, Normandie, France.
  • She died on October 22, 1663 in St Martin Sur Renelle, Normandie, France, she was 45 years old.

Household of Barbe Lechevalier

She is married to Jacques Lamy.

They got married in the year 1639 at St Martin Sur Renelle, Rouen, Normandie, France, she was 21 years old.


Child(ren):

  1. Joseph Isaac Lamy  1640-1735 
  2. Jacques Lamy  1640-1685 
  3. Marie Lamy  1653-1733
